How hard is it to cancel Sky UK?

Sky UK scores 64/100 (grade C) for how clearly it documents cancellation in the UK, a partially documented cancellation policy with notable gaps. Cancellation is available via phone, online (self-serve), in-app, email.

Last reviewed 2026-06-05 · Documented-Policy tier · grade C

To cancel Sky TV, customers must give 31 days' notice (14 days for broadband/talk); cancellation is initiated by calling Sky (0344 241 4141), via live chat, through My Sky online account, or in writing, but Sky requires phone verification before acting on written/email requests. Sky offers an enhanced 31-day cooling-off period (above the statutory 14 days) during which full refunds including delivery costs apply; outside cooling-off, no mid-period refunds are given but credit for advance-billed overpayment is returned within approximately 6 weeks. Early termination during a minimum-term contract incurs charges equal to the remaining discounted term; early cancellation charge rates changed as of 31 March 2026. The UK CMA's auto-renewal guidance applies, but Sky does not provide a single-click online cancellation button, the online journey at sky.com/cancel funnels into phone or chat to complete the request.

How to cancel Sky UK

  • Channels: phone, online (self-serve), in-app, email

  • Pause/freeze: not offered. Sky does not offer a pause or freeze option for TV or broadband subscriptions. Customers must either continue or cancel with the required notice period.
  • Account/data deletion: Sky acknowledges a GDPR right to erasure. Customers can initiate a deletion request via the Sky Privacy Hub rights page. Records are typically retained for up to 7 years post-cancellation for legal/billing reasons before secure deletion or anonymisation.
